Wales and Arsenal great Aaron Ramsey retires from football aged 35

Aaron Ramsey Bows Out: The End of an Era for Wales and Arsenal

The final whistle has blown on a career that defined a generation for Welsh football and illuminated the Premier League for a decade. Aaron Ramsey, the midfielder whose elegant grace and perfectly timed runs became his trademark, has announced his immediate retirement from professional football at the age of 35. The decision closes the chapter on a player whose journey—from Cardiff prodigy to Arsenal icon, Juventus star, and unwavering Welsh talisman—was punctuated by seismic highs, cruel setbacks, and an enduring legacy of decisive moments on the grandest stages.

A Career Forged in Resilience and Glory

Ramsey’s story is one of remarkable mental fortitude. Bursting onto the scene with his boyhood club Cardiff City, his potential was undeniable, leading to a move to Arsenal in 2008. His trajectory, however, was horrifically altered in 2010 by a double leg fracture following a challenge from Stoke City’s Ryan Shawcross. Many wondered if he would ever return to his best. What followed was a testament to his character: a painstaking rehabilitation and a triumphant return that saw him evolve into one of the Premier League’s most complete midfielders.

At Arsenal, Ramsey became the heartbeat of a team ending a long trophy drought. He will forever be immortalized in FA Cup folklore for his winning goals in two FA Cup finals—the extra-time winner against Hull City in 2014 to end Arsenal’s nine-year trophy wait, and the sublime, instinctive strike against Chelsea in 2017. His partnership with Mesut Özil was telepathic, with Ramsey’s late bursts into the box becoming a primary weapon in Arsène Wenger’s arsenal.

  • Arsenal Legacy: 369 appearances, 65 goals, 3 FA Cup triumphs.
  • Defining Moment: The 2014 FA Cup final winner, a cathartic moment for player and club.
  • Unique Honour: The only player to score winning goals in two separate FA Cup finals in the modern era.

The Dragon’s Heart: A Welsh Legend

If his club career was illustrious, his service to Wales was legendary. Emerging alongside Gareth Bale and Joe Allen as part of the “Golden Generation,” Ramsey was the sophisticated engine of the greatest Welsh team in decades. His pinnacle came at UEFA Euro 2016, where he was utterly magnificent, orchestrating play and scoring a crucial goal as Wales defied all odds to reach the semi-finals. His suspension for that final four clash was a heartbreaking blow, arguably diminishing Wales’s chance of reaching the ultimate match.

As captain, he later led his nation to a first World Cup in 64 years in 2022, a crowning achievement for his international service. With 86 caps and 21 goals, he retires as one of Wales’s most decorated and influential players of all time, his technical quality elevating the entire side.

Wales Manager Rob Page on Ramsey: “He’s probably one of the best players we’ve ever produced. His technical ability, his work rate off the ball, what he gave to the team… he’ll be sorely missed.”

The Curtain Call and What Comes Next

Ramsey’s final playing chapter was a globe-trotting quest for rhythm and a final World Cup dream. After a high-profile move to Juventus and a stint at Rangers, his last stop was with Pumas UNAM in Mexico. The clear objective was to maintain fitness for the 2022 World Cup playoff. Once Wales’s qualification hopes ended, the driving force for his continued playing career diminished. His statement, noting the difficulty of the decision, reflects a player who has given everything to the game and is choosing to step away on his own terms.

So, what does the future hold for Aaron Ramsey? His intelligence, experience, and deep understanding of the game make a move into coaching or management a strong possibility. Many former teammates speak of his tactical acumen. Furthermore, his dignified persona and eloquence could see him transition into punditry or an ambassadorial role, potentially with the Football Association of Wales or Arsenal.

Expert Analysis: “Ramsey’s career arc is a masterclass in adaptation,” says football analyst David Hughes. “He evolved from a dynamic box-to-box player into a strategic, tempo-setting midfielder. His football IQ is exceptionally high, which is why a coaching pathway seems a natural progression. He has the respect of a generation of players in two countries.”

Legacy of a Modern Midfield Maestro

Aaron Ramsey’s legacy is multifaceted. For Arsenal fans, he is the handsome prince of the FA Cup, the scorer of goals that delivered tangible joy and ended barren spells. For Wales, he is an immortal figure in their football renaissance, a central pillar in the greatest era of their history. Beyond the trophies and accolades, he represented a style—a blend of industry and artistry, of relentless running and refined technique.

He retires not with the fanfare of a global superstar, but with the profound respect of peers, fans, and pundits who appreciated the nuance and significance of his contributions. In an era of flashier talents, Ramsey’s greatness was in his timing: the timing of his runs, his tackles, and his goals when they mattered most.

Final Whistle: The football world bids farewell to a player of rare grace and resilience. Aaron Ramsey’s name is etched in the history books of Arsenal and Welsh football, not just for what he won, but for how he played and the hope he embodied. His retirement marks the true end of Wales’s Golden Generation and a beloved chapter for the Gunners. The midfield maestro has left the pitch, but his highlights—those galloping runs and Wembley magic—will replay forever.
